The Internet of Things revolution is gaining a huge momentum and now it's the time to see how 5G network is going to change it. Since study shows that devices connected to IoT will cross 20 billion by the year 2020, the wireless networks that enable these will need to be improved to manage that huge jump in numbers. The demand for storage and communication is increasing rapidly for our systems, therefore, reducing the importance of the 4G network.

This is where 5G network comes into action. IoT is continuing to grow from the past few years and new as well as innovative ways are being developed to improve the volume of transmitted data for the existing environment to match with the predicted increase in connected devices. There are various ways in which 5G wireless mobile internet can help shape future of the Internet of Things.
Let's look at a few of the different aspects of the Internet of Things that 5G technologies will look to improve upon.
Data: The most evident impact the execution of 5G technologies will have on the Internet of Things is its capability to share significantly larger volumes of data at a faster speed than 4G. Utilizing more developed communication strategies, like MIMO, to boost 5G networks implies that more data can be sent and received in a substantially short span of time. Numerous transmitters and receivers spread over large areas work much better than single antennas spread further apart.
